One-Way Slab Design
Determine minimum thickness, required flexural reinforcement, and temperature/shrinkage steel for a one-way slab spanning between parallel supports. Checks concrete shear capacity without stirrups and verifies that the selected thickness satisfies ACI 318-19 Table 7.3.1.1 minimum thickness for deflection control. Includes distribution reinforcement requirements.
What this calculates
Minimum slab thickness (h) for deflection control per Table 7.3.1.1, required main reinforcement (As), temperature and shrinkage reinforcement (As,t&s per Section 24.4.3), concrete shear capacity (φVc), and maximum bar spacing limits per Section 7.7.2.

Methodology
Minimum thickness per ACI 318-19 Table 7.3.1.1 (e.g. L/20 for simply supported, L/24 for one end continuous). Flexural reinforcement using Mu = φ·As·fy·(d − a/2) per Section 22.2. Temperature and shrinkage steel: As,t&s = 0.0018·b·h for Grade 60 reinforcement per Section 24.4.3.2. Shear check: φVc = φ·2·√f'c·b·d per Section 22.5. Maximum bar spacing: min(3h, 18 in) per Section 7.7.2.3.
